UNCG moves up to 10th on final day at Palmetto

AIKEN, S.C. – UNC Greensboro carded a final round 301 to move up to a tenth place finish at the Cleveland Golf Palmetto Intercollegiate men’s golf tournament.

John Isenhour and Will Bowman led the way for UNCG in the final round with scores of 72 and 75. repectively. Nathan Stamey was UNCG’s best finisher, placing in a tie for 26th place after shooting 77 in the final round.

Chattanooga coasted to the team championship, winning by 30 shots over second place Virginia Tech. The Mocs shot 282 on the final day to extend what began the day as a 16-shot lead. Chattanooga’s Jonathan Hodge carded the best round of the day, a 67, to rally for the individual title at 212. He won by one shot over a trio of golfers.

UNCG returns to action on Sunday when they begin play at the Pinehurst Intercollegiate.
